11th Circ. Denies Doc Stay To Appeal Libel Suit To Justices
The Eleventh Circuit on Wednesday refused to hold off on dismissing a doctor's defamation suit against a Yale neurologist who allegedly implied he was a quack in a blog post criticizing his off-label use of the arthritis treatment Enbrel, as the doctor appeals to the U.S. Supreme Court.

Doctor Asks 11th Circ. To Rehear Enbrel Libel Case
A doctor with a patented but clinically unproven method for treating stroke and other ailments has asked the full Eleventh Circuit to rehear his defamation case against a Yale neurologist who likened the technique to quackery in a blog post.

11th Circ. Affirms Toss Of Dispute Over Enbrel Use
The Eleventh Circuit on Wednesday affirmed a number of Florida federal court orders that ended a doctor's defamation suit against a Yale neurologist who blogged about the physician's unorthodox use of arthritis treatment Enbrel to treat post-stroke brain issues and other ailments.
